Strawberry Cucumber Salad

Servings 4 servings
Calories 70 kcal
- 2 cups sliced strawberries
- 1 large English cucumber thinly sliced
- 1 tablespoon chopped fresh mint leaves
- 1 tablespoon fresh lime juice
- 1 tablespoon honey
- 1 teaspoon olive oil
- Pinch of sea salt
- Freshly ground black pepper to taste
Wash and dry the strawberries and cucumber thoroughly.
Slice the strawberries into thin slices or quarters, depending on size.
Thinly slice the cucumber into rounds. If using a standard cucumber, remove the seeds for best texture.
In a small bowl, whisk together the lime juice, honey, olive oil, sea salt, and black pepper.
In a large mixing bowl, combine the sliced strawberries and cucumber.
Drizzle the dressing over the salad and toss gently to combine.
Sprinkle chopped mint over the top as garnish.
Serve immediately or chill briefly before serving.
